package android.app.cts;
import android.app.Activity;
import android.content.Intent;
import android.os.AsyncTask;
import android.os.Bundle;
import android.util.Log;
/**
* {@link Activity} that allocates arrays of 256k until reaching 75% of the specified memory class.
*/
public class ActivityManagerMemoryClassTestActivity extends Activity {
private static final String TAG = "ActivityManagerMemoryClassTest";
private static final double FREE_MEMORY_PERCENTAGE = 0.75;
private static final int ARRAY_BYTES_SIZE = 256 * 1024;
@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
Intent intent = getIntent();
int memoryClass =
intent.getIntExtra(ActivityManagerMemoryClassLaunchActivity.MEMORY_CLASS_EXTRA, -1);
new AllocateMemoryTask(memoryClass).execute();
}
private class AllocateMemoryTask extends AsyncTask<Void, Void, Void> {
private final int mMemoryClass;
AllocateMemoryTask(int memoryClass) {
this.mMemoryClass = memoryClass;
}
@Override
protected Void doInBackground(Void... params) {
int targetMbs = (int) (mMemoryClass * FREE_MEMORY_PERCENTAGE);
int numArrays = targetMbs * 1024 * 1024 / ARRAY_BYTES_SIZE;
Log.i(TAG, "Memory class: " + mMemoryClass + "mb Target memory: "
+ targetMbs + "mb Number of arrays: " + numArrays);
byte[][] arrays = new byte[numArrays][];
for (int i = 0; i < arrays.length; i++) {
Log.i(TAG, "Allocating array " + i + " of " + arrays.length
+ " (" + (i * ARRAY_BYTES_SIZE / 1024 / 1024) + "mb)");
arrays[i] = new byte[ARRAY_BYTES_SIZE];
}
return null;
}
@Override
protected void onPostExecute(Void result) {
super.onPostExecute(result);
setResult(RESULT_OK);
finish();
}
}
}
